Though it was hinted to us that Young ASTLEY’s Benefit would take place this evening, yet we had out doubts, from the multiplicity of unfinished matter, which was supposed could not be got ready in time; however, by the industry of both the ASTLEY’s, and an additional number of painters, this obstacle has been completely done away---a general rehearsal took place last night, which for brilliancy and variety, will most assuredly prove a high treat to the frequenters of Young ASTLEY’s Benefit this night. We have no occasion to publish the excellence of Young ASTLEY on horseback---his fame and reputation is well known throughout all Europe; we have only to say, that in the rehearsal of last night, he not only on his horses performed wonders, but wonderfully amazed us on the stage, in his Harlequin, &c.
